Nettipattam, also known as “elephant caparison” or “elephant ornament,” is a traditional and ornate decoration used in Kerala, India, particularly in festivals and processions involving elephants.  Intricate Craftsmanship and Cultural Symbolism:

  • Artistic Detail: Nettipattam is renowned for its intricate craftsmanship and attention to detail. Each piece is carefully handcrafted by skilled artisans who invest hours of work into creating these ornate decorations.
  • Cultural Symbolism: Nettipattam holds immense cultural and religious significance in Kerala. It is an integral part of temple festivals, traditional ceremonies, and processions involving elephants. These decorations symbolize grandeur, spirituality, and the rich heritage of Kerala.
  • Distinct Designs: Nettipattam comes in various designs and patterns, often featuring motifs and symbols from Hindu mythology. The designs vary depending on the specific purpose, whether it’s for temple rituals or ceremonial processions.
